CLARMIN RESOURCES INC. ANNOUNCES RESULTS OF THE 2018 FIELD PROGRAM ON THE ARLINGTON PROPERTY

Clarmin Exploration Inc. has completed a soil geochemical and prospecting program on the company's Arlington project to evaluate the potential for extending anomalous copper-silver soil geochemical results identified in 2017. The Arlington property is located 18 kilometres north of the Hamlet of Beaverdell and the historic silver-copper-lead-zinc mines of the Beaverdell mining camp located in the Greenwood mining division. The 2018 field program at the Arlington property has been completed, consisting of a soil geochemical, rock sampling and prospecting program over newly extended grid lines between the north and south grids to evaluate the potential for extending anomalous copper and silver soil anomalies outlined during the 2017 exploration field program.

The results of the 2018 soil geochemical sampling program have extended anomalous copper and silver soil geochemical results through the sampled area between the two grids. Mapping and prospecting programs to date indicate that anomalous copper, silver plus/minus lead and zinc soil geochemical anomalies appear to reflect the close proximity of the underlying contact between Carboniferous to Permian Anarchist group volcanic tuffs and Middle Jurassic diorite of the Nelson Plutonic suite. Mapping and prospecting in the areas of anomalous copper soil geochemistry shows that outcrop exposure is generally less than 5 per cent and, in those areas where outcrop was located, the Anarchist group was generally found to be a dense, dark green flaky chlorite biotite hornblende schist, which frequently contains magnetite, pyrite and trace chalcopyrite as accessory minerals. Wherever this unit was encountered, the rock was strongly fractured, quite magnetic and locally brecciated with quartz, K feldspar and epidote breccia-fracture filling and veining. The contact between the Anarchist group rocks and the Nelson Plutonic suite in this area is sinuous, trending to the north-northwest. The soil geochemical surveys locally highlight structurally controlled east-west trending fractures and shears, which locally host copper, silver plus/minus gold mineralization within diorites of the Nelson Plutonic suite and locally within the Anarchist group.

Prospecting in the southern portions of the property located the Black Minfile occurrence. The Black Minfile occurrence consists of a series of northwest-trending historical trenches and test pits exposing a 20-centimetre quartz vein hosting disseminations of pyrite, chalcopyrite and molybdenite. A grab sample of the mineralized vein returned 1.05 per cent Cu, 37.65 grams per tonne Ag, 0.13 g/t Au and 3,556.4 parts per million Mo. It should be noted that grab samples by nature are selective and therefore may not be representative of the mineralization being evaluated. Soil grid lines were extended to cover the Black showing and its potential strike extension. Results of the soil geochemical survey over the Black showing failed to return any significant results along strike.

The company is currently evaluating the above results determining the next steps on the Arlington property, in addition to evaluating various strategic alternatives.
